Common Types of Cancer in Switzerland

When it comes to common types of cancer in Switzerland, several stand out as being particularly prevalent. These include breast cancer, lung cancer, colorectal cancer, prostate cancer, and skin cancer. Each of these cancers has its own set of risk factors, screening methods, and treatment approaches, making it essential to understand them individually.

Breast cancer is one of the most frequently diagnosed cancers among women in Switzerland. Factors contributing to its high incidence include genetic predispositions, hormonal factors, and lifestyle choices. Regular screening through mammography is recommended to detect breast cancer early, when treatment is most effective. Advances in treatment, such as targeted therapies and hormone therapies, have significantly improved outcomes for breast cancer patients.

Lung cancer is another significant concern, often linked to smoking and exposure to environmental pollutants. Despite efforts to reduce smoking rates, lung cancer remains a leading cause of cancer-related deaths in Switzerland. Early detection can be challenging, as symptoms may not appear until the cancer has advanced. However, screening programs for high-risk individuals are being explored to improve early detection rates. New treatments, including immunotherapy and targeted therapies, offer hope for better outcomes.

Colorectal cancer is also quite common, affecting both men and women. Risk factors include age, family history, and dietary habits. Screening through colonoscopy and stool tests is recommended to detect and remove precancerous polyps before they develop into cancer. Treatment options include surgery, chemotherapy, and radiation therapy, with outcomes improving through early detection and advancements in treatment protocols.

Prostate cancer primarily affects older men, with incidence rates increasing with age. Screening through prostate-specific antigen (PSA) tests can help detect prostate cancer early, although there is ongoing debate about the benefits and risks of widespread screening. Treatment options vary depending on the stage and aggressiveness of the cancer, ranging from active surveillance to surgery, radiation therapy, and hormone therapy.

Skin cancer, including melanoma and non-melanoma skin cancers, is also on the rise in Switzerland. Exposure to ultraviolet (UV) radiation from the sun is a major risk factor. Prevention strategies include wearing protective clothing, using sunscreen, and avoiding tanning beds. Early detection through regular skin exams is crucial, as melanoma can be deadly if not treated promptly. Treatment options include surgical removal, radiation therapy, and targeted therapies.

Risk Factors and Prevention Strategies

Risk factors and prevention strategies are super important when we talk about cancer in Switzerland. Identifying what puts people at risk and knowing how to lower those risks can seriously impact cancer rates. Let's break down the main risk factors and what you can do to stay healthy.

First off, lifestyle choices play a massive role. Smoking is a biggie, directly linked to lung, throat, and bladder cancers. Encouraging people to quit smoking and preventing folks from starting in the first place is a key focus. Then there's diet. A diet high in processed foods, red meat, and low in fruits and veggies can up your risk of colorectal and other cancers. Promoting a balanced diet full of whole foods is a smart move.

Physical activity is another piece of the puzzle. Staying active helps maintain a healthy weight, which can lower the risk of breast, endometrial, and colon cancers. Regular exercise, even just a brisk walk, can make a difference. And let's not forget about alcohol. Heavy drinking is tied to liver, breast, and esophageal cancers. Moderation is key here.

Next, there are environmental factors. Exposure to certain chemicals and pollutants can increase cancer risk. This includes things like asbestos, radon, and air pollution. Efforts to regulate these substances and reduce environmental pollution are essential. UV radiation from the sun is a major risk factor for skin cancer. Protecting your skin with sunscreen, hats, and protective clothing can significantly lower your risk.

Genetic factors also come into play. Some people inherit gene mutations that increase their likelihood of developing certain cancers, like breast and ovarian cancer (BRCA genes) or colorectal cancer ( Lynch syndrome). Genetic testing and counseling can help individuals understand their risk and make informed decisions about screening and prevention.

Lastly, infections can sometimes lead to cancer. For example, the human papillomavirus (HPV) is linked to cervical and other cancers. Vaccination against HPV is a powerful tool for prevention. Hepatitis B and C viruses can increase the risk of liver cancer. Vaccination and treatment of these infections are important preventive measures.

The Swiss Healthcare System and Cancer Care

The Swiss healthcare system is known for its high quality and comprehensive coverage, which plays a critical role in cancer care. The system is based on a combination of mandatory health insurance and public and private healthcare providers. Understanding how this system supports cancer patients is essential for both residents and those interested in the Swiss approach to healthcare.

Switzerland operates under a decentralized healthcare model, with cantons (states) having significant autonomy in healthcare provision. Mandatory health insurance ensures that all residents have access to essential medical services, including cancer screening, diagnosis, and treatment. Insurers are required to cover a defined package of benefits, although individuals can choose different levels of coverage with varying premiums.

Cancer care in Switzerland is delivered through a network of hospitals, specialized cancer centers, and private practices. These facilities are equipped with advanced technology and staffed by highly trained oncologists, surgeons, and other healthcare professionals. Multidisciplinary teams collaborate to develop individualized treatment plans for each patient, ensuring that they receive the most appropriate and effective care.

Access to cancer screening programs is an important component of the Swiss healthcare system. Screening programs for breast cancer, cervical cancer, and colorectal cancer are available to eligible individuals, with the goal of detecting cancers at an early, more treatable stage. These programs are often organized at the cantonal level, with efforts to ensure equitable access across different regions.

Cancer treatment in Switzerland encompasses a range of modalities, including surgery, radiation therapy, chemotherapy, targeted therapy, and immunotherapy. Treatment decisions are based on evidence-based guidelines and take into account the patient's overall health, preferences, and the specific characteristics of their cancer. Supportive care services, such as pain management, psychological counseling, and nutritional support, are also integrated into the treatment plan to address the holistic needs of patients.

The Swiss healthcare system also places a strong emphasis on quality improvement and patient safety. Hospitals and healthcare providers are subject to regular audits and accreditation processes to ensure that they meet high standards of care. Cancer registries collect data on cancer incidence, treatment, and outcomes, providing valuable information for monitoring trends and evaluating the effectiveness of different interventions.

The Future of Cancer Care in Switzerland

Looking ahead, the future of cancer care in Switzerland is poised for significant advancements, driven by ongoing research, technological innovations, and evolving healthcare strategies. Several key trends and developments are expected to shape the landscape of cancer prevention, diagnosis, treatment, and survivorship in the coming years.

One major focus is on personalized medicine. As our understanding of the genetic and molecular basis of cancer deepens, treatments are becoming increasingly tailored to the individual patient. Genomic sequencing, biomarker analysis, and other advanced diagnostic tools are being used to identify specific characteristics of a patient's cancer, allowing oncologists to select the most effective therapies and minimize side effects.

Immunotherapy is another rapidly evolving field with great promise for cancer treatment. These therapies harness the power of the immune system to recognize and destroy cancer cells. New types of immunotherapies, such as checkpoint inhibitors and CAR-T cell therapy, are showing remarkable results in certain cancers, and research is ongoing to expand their application to other tumor types.

Early detection remains a critical priority. Efforts are underway to improve existing screening programs and develop new methods for detecting cancer at its earliest stages, when treatment is most likely to be successful. This includes exploring the use of liquid biopsies, which can detect cancer DNA or other biomarkers in blood samples, and developing more sensitive imaging techniques.

Minimally invasive surgical techniques are becoming increasingly common, offering patients less pain, shorter hospital stays, and faster recovery times. Robotic surgery, laparoscopic surgery, and other advanced surgical approaches are being used to treat a variety of cancers, with ongoing research focused on refining these techniques and expanding their applications.

Survivorship care is also gaining increasing attention. As more people are living longer after a cancer diagnosis, there is a growing need for comprehensive support services to address the physical, emotional, and practical challenges that survivors face. This includes providing access to rehabilitation programs, psychological counseling, and support groups, as well as addressing long-term side effects of treatment.
